If you're a real fan of Randall Boggs, from the 2001 Disney/Pixar movie, "Monsters, Inc.", YOU NEED TO READ THIS!
It's all but official now that Pixar IS making a sequel to that movie, which will be released in either 2012 or 2013, with Peter Docter once again directing. No information yet as to the storyline, plot, setting(s), character/casting, BUT this means one of three scenarios, insofar as Randall returning is concerned.

Scenario One: Randall does NOT appear in the sequel, possibly does not even get mentioned, and either Pixar decides they don't really need a "bad guy", or they get some other character for Mike and Sulley to beat up/defeat.

Scenario Two: Randall DOES return, but is once more negatively stereotyped as the epitome of all Evil, reinforcing that mind-set that all reptilian or scaly creatures must be evil and horrible and can be no other way. He once more is a threat to poor Mike and Sulley and possibly Boo or some other innocent little human kid, and once more is defeated by them. THAT can only mean ONE thing this time around, folks: Randall DIES. Not a "did he or didn't he get killed" ending, but one that will leave no doubt that he's dead.

Scenario Three: Randall returns, possibly starting out on a sour note, out for revenge against the two who lynched him(yeah, you read that right), but due perhaps to the intervention of another character, he undergoes a gradual, plausible character arc, and finally get that chance to show that side of him that many of us KNEW was there all along, in line with Stitch's character arc in "Lilo and Stitch"

Now, MY choice, without a doubt, is Scenario Three. It would be nice, through this character, if Pixar would take the chance to explore two themes that they have not really touched on much: FORGIVENESS and SECOND CHANCES. I'd much rather see that, than the worn-out Saturday morning kiddie cartoon formula of "Good Guys vs. Bad Guys, Good Guys Beat Up Bad Guys and Get All The Rewards".
